Choosing the Right Accommodation for Your Extended Stay

Extended vacations or long-term travel require more than just a place to sleep. You need an environment that complements your needs for work, relaxation, and exploration. Here are some ideal options to consider for your extended getaway:

  1. Vacation Rentals: A Home Away from Home

Vacation rentals, such as those found on platforms https://www.amorehotelapartments.com/ like Airbnb or Vrbo, are increasingly popular for longer stays. These options offer the benefit of extra space, a full kitchen, and often more flexibility than traditional hotels. Many vacation rentals come with amenities that make your stay feel like home, such as laundry facilities, outdoor spaces, and a fully stocked kitchen. These elements allow you to enjoy the comforts of daily life while away from home, ensuring that you can maintain your usual routine while also enjoying new experiences.

Moreover, the cost of vacation rentals often becomes more economical the longer your stay, with discounts for weekly or monthly bookings. This makes it an attractive option for budget-conscious travelers looking for value.

  1. Boutique Hotels: Personalized and Unique Stays

For those who prefer a bit more luxury and service, boutique hotels can be the perfect option for an extended stay. These smaller, independently owned properties usually offer a more personalized experience than large chain hotels, with unique decor, attentive staff, and often fewer crowds. Many boutique hotels now offer long-term rates, including discounted monthly packages.

Another perk of boutique hotels is their emphasis on comfort and design. With higher quality furnishings and more cozy amenities than budget chains, boutique hotels tend to provide a more aesthetically pleasing atmosphere for longer stays. The staff often know you by name, making you feel like part of a community during your time away.

  1. Serviced Apartments: The Best of Both Worlds

Serviced apartments combine the comfort and privacy of renting a home with the convenience of hotel-style amenities. These properties typically offer a full range of services, including cleaning, concierge, and on-site facilities like gyms or pools. Many serviced apartments are located in key urban areas, making them ideal for travelers who want to stay for an extended period while still being close to the action.

One of the main benefits of serviced apartments is the sense of independence they provide, with full kitchens and living spaces. You can cook your own meals, enjoy larger rooms, and have the freedom to come and go as you please. This option is particularly well-suited for business travelers or those looking for a more home-like atmosphere without sacrificing convenience.

  1. Co-living Spaces: A Social Twist on Extended Stays

For a more community-oriented option, consider co-living spaces. These modern, shared accommodation solutions offer private rooms within a larger communal setting. With a focus on collaboration and social interaction, co-living spaces are perfect for solo travelers looking to meet others. Many co-living spaces provide workspaces, organized events, and other networking opportunities, making them especially appealing to digital nomads or remote workers.

Co-living spaces are often located in trendy, well-connected neighborhoods, allowing you to explore new areas while having a built-in social circle. If you’re traveling for several months and want a blend of comfort, convenience, and social engagement, this option is worth considering.

  1. Luxury Resorts: Ultimate Comfort and Relaxation

If indulgence and relaxation are your primary goals, a luxury resort may be the perfect choice for an extended stay. These properties offer top-notch service, spa treatments, fine dining, and every amenity you could imagine. Resorts often feature pools, gyms, and private beaches, ensuring that your getaway is as leisurely and comfortable as possible.

Many resorts also offer long-term rates, making them more accessible for travelers seeking a luxurious extended vacation. While they can be more expensive than other options, the all-inclusive services and serene surroundings often make up for the higher price tag. You’ll also have access to organized activities and excursions, allowing you to fully immerse yourself in the local culture.

Considerations for Choosing Your Perfect Stay

No matter which type of accommodation you choose, there are several factors to keep in mind when booking an extended stay:

  • Location: Choose a location that offers easy access to the activities you want to do. If you’re in a city for business, proximity to your office or meeting locations is important. If you’re on vacation, look for destinations with attractions, dining, and entertainment nearby.
  • Amenities: The right amenities can make your long stay much more enjoyable. Look for accommodations with facilities like free Wi-Fi, laundry services, a kitchen, and parking if needed. Depending on your destination, having access to a gym, pool, or even a workspace may also be important.
  • Budget: Long-term stays can be more affordable when booked through the right channels. Compare rates and look for promotions or discounts for extended stays. Remember, staying in one place for a longer period can help you save on travel and dining costs.
  • Comfort and Cleanliness: No one wants to spend an extended period in a place that doesn’t meet basic comfort and cleanliness standards. Pay attention to guest reviews and make sure the accommodation is well-maintained and suited to your needs.
